Actionable Takeaways
- Monitor PAGCOR guidance and Philippine regulatory updates for any changes affecting cross-border sports betting and offshore platforms listing KBL-related bets.
- Assess risk management practices for PH operators considering KBL content, including customer verification, geolocation, and responsible gambling controls.
- For investors, differentiate between league momentum signals (fan engagement, media rights trends) and concrete financial opportunities (licensed product launches, sponsorship deals) that have regulatory green lights in PH.
- Favor operators and platforms with transparent data practices and public risk disclosures when introducing KBL-linked betting products.
- Support responsible betting by educating readers about limits, self-exclusion options, and the importance of data privacy in cross-border wagers.
